Action item from the Brightgale leak postmortem: verify EXIF scrubbing on all upload paths. The Pixmarrow scrubber currently runs only on the web uploader; the mobile sync path bypasses it entirely. Add the scrub step to the Ferndock ingest worker and write a regression test that rejects any stored image with GPS tags. Scrubber config and test fixtures are documented at the following internal page.

dashboard of bafof-hafog = https://confluence.lumiclabs.internal/display/browse/display/6a09a20a

**Q: How are user-supplied formulas sandboxed in Tallygrove?**

Formulas run inside the Quillbox interpreter: no I/O, no imports, 50ms CPU cap, 4MB memory cap. Identifiers resolve only against the whitelisted field table. Anything else throws a SandboxViolation and gets logged. Do not add builtins without a security review. Never eval formulas outside Quillbox, even in tests. For sandbox escape reports or whitelist change requests, contact the Formula Safety group at the address below.

alerts address for kajog-tadup: druox@plorvanet.internal

## Service Accounts — StormFan Alert Fan-Out

The fan-out worker authenticates to the internal dispatch tier using the svc-stormfan account. Rotate quarterly; scopes are limited to publish-only on alert topics. If deliveries stall during your shift, verify the worker is using the current credential, reproduced below for reference.

API key for kaweg-hahif: kto4_rAjZ

Almost done, team! This one covers the escrow key for the Hushpine typo-squatting package scanner — the thing support leans on when a suspicious lookalike package gets reported. Make sure the laptop stays offline, have both witnesses initial the log, and double-check the key fingerprint against the printed sheet before sealing anything. If a customer escalation ever requires emergency decryption of quarantined scan archives, you'll need the escrow envelope. For the record, the recovery passphrase is written just below.

unlock words, hahip-yagef: zorok-novmir-zorix-silax